#2935b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2935bb is composed of 16.1% red, 20.8%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.1% cyan, 71.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 235.1 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 44.7%. #2935bb color hex could be obtained by blending #526aff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2935b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030a is the darkest color, while #f9f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2935b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7075 is the less saturated color, while #0618de is the most saturated one.
